Output 8f631d567c0b181522a31c5d1f53ebac7c0f04c40fe7b1b827b9cf3188e06345:3

value
8770370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 668e8713150d2a35253f63cb0b4569781f772208 OP_EQUAL
address
3B3Hb6zb2wreMRXTkUfedhGTMB4UVWCFqb
transaction
8f631d567c0b181522a31c5d1f53ebac7c0f04c40fe7b1b827b9cf3188e06345